I used to cut off nutes at the last week. I never cut it off 2 weeks out. I used to cut it back as the plants seem to slow down in the last 7-10 days (or there about) and I feel like I am just wasting nutes by continuing to give the higher "flowering" levels. But I have discovered that the "slow down" can vary widely from strain to strain and situation to situation. Plus, I more often than not do my harvest in staggered stages. In doing that I found that the lower buds will fatten up and ripen up significantly if the plants have continued access to nutes. So now I have food available to them pretty much right up to the day that I pull the stumps out of the pots.
